By the river, but away from the heavily toured areas of the river and town. It's family owned, very clean, very nice garden and a small swimming pool. The food is absolutely great. There's a nice village about 1 km up the road, with a small daily afternoon market that is worth a visit. Along the road there are plenty of tobacco and roselle (used for hibiscus tea) fields.

We booked with a direct phone call while we were in another area of the country. It helped that we speak Thai. Upon our arrival it was notable that though it was high season very few of the rooms were occupied. We are very undemanding guests and in general we were pleased enough with cleanliness and comfort. What is readily apparent is that the couple who own the place have separated. Dennis, whom we did not meet, is no longer around. His wife seemed a bit overwhelmed and did not want to book more than a few rooms at a time. It seems like ownership may change. For now it is fine, though we had our own vehicle and were not interested in having breakfast. The pool was clean and well maintained.
